Two die in accident

Published January 4, 2008

SAHIWAL, Jan 3: Two members of a family were killed, while four others, including the car driver, were injured in a road accident on Sahiwal-Faisalabad Road late on Wednesday night.

A family was returning to its home in Faisalabad’s Madina Town after attending a marriage in Arifwala when their speeding car rammed into a donkey cart. Resultantly, Gul Muhammad and his nephew, Hakeem Khan, died at the scene and children Saeed Khan (12), Aqeel Khan (10) and Munni Rani (8) and driver Zafar were injured seriously.

The injured were admitted to a local public hospital, where Zafar was said to be critical.

PROTEST: Hundreds of lawyers, on the call of the Pakistan Bar Council and the Lahore High Court Bar Association, staged a rally to condemn the assassination of Benazir Bhutto and removal of Chief Justice Iftikhar Muhammad Chaudhry.

The protesting lawyers, led by District Bar Association President Sheikh Muhammad Usman and others, raised anti-government slogans.

The rally, which started from district courts and marched through the city, dispersed at the barroom peacefully. The protesters, wearing black armbands, hoisted black flags at the barroom and boycotted the courts.
